  2. Seymour played in seven Pro Bowls, was named to five All-Pro teams, and was a member of three Super Bowl -winning Patriots teams. During his career, Seymour was considered to be one of the best defensive linemen in the NFL. [2] [3] Seymour was elected into the Pro Football Hall of Fame in 2022.
